Hi guys,

I don't know if this has been answered already somewhere but I wanted to know of anybody has retrofitted a automatic boot on a A6 Avant? Is it straight forward?

Thank in advance

Yes i have done it and its not difficult to do. Mainly removing panels and running wires.
 
Is there any specific parts required or a parts list needed somewhere?

Sent from my ONEPLUS 6T McLaren using Tapatalk
 
List wise you would need:
Pair of motors, control unit, wiring loom, gas struts, locking motor, tailgate switch. I take it you have a 2011-2013 model if it hasnt got the auto boot as standard. Pre and post facelift motors and its ecu are different as are the wires.
If you want to do the full retrofit then you will add the auto retracting load cover; so you would add some D pillar trims, drive unit with cables and again more wiring. Luckily the same parcel shelf can be reused.
